UK Charts: Week Ending 9th October

It seems that gamers have voted with their wallets, as PES 2011 fails to knock FIFA 11 from the top spot.  Bemused by flying balls and lack of zombies, Dead Rising 2 watches from third place.  F1 2010 and Halo continue their slow slip down the charts, and it’s good to see Castlevania and Enslaved make an impact.

Wii Party makes its debut at number ten, accompanied by a hilarious advert featuring pop group JLS; oh the hand gestures!  Despite the demo not floating many boats, WRC does enough to chart at number eleven.

Oddest event of the week is Modern Warfare 2 jumping up eight places.  Surely everyone in the world has at least three copies by now?
